Abstract

This item consists of the photocopied field journal of Cameron B. Kepler documenting his work with the Pacific Ocean Biological Survey in 1964 and 1965. The descriptive accounts include observations of birds, bird behavior, observations of the environment, and some plant collection activities. Most of the content reflects Kepler's work banding sea birds in and around Hawaii.
